How to comment on a file
To comment on a file:
- Sign in to dropbox.com.
- Click All files in the left sidebar.
- Click the name of the file you want to comment on.
- Click Comments in the right sidebar.
- If the right sidebar isn’t open, click the arrow or Comments button on the right-side of the screen.
- Type your comment.
- To mention someone in your comment, type @ and then their name or click the @ icon.
- Click Post.
How to comment on a specific part of a file
To comment on a specific part of a file:
- Sign in to dropbox.com.
- Click All files in the left sidebar.
- Click the name of the file you want to comment on.
- Click Comments in the right sidebar.
- If the right sidebar isn’t open, click the arrow or Comments button on the right-side of the screen.
- Click the circle with a plus sign next to Add your thoughts.
- Click and drag a box around the area of the file you’d like to comment on.
- Click the comment box in the right sidebar.
- Type your comment.
- Click Post.

How to edit or delete a comment
To edit or delete a comment:
- Sign in to dropbox.com.
- Click All files in the left sidebar.
- Click the name of the file you want to comment on.
- Click Comments in the right sidebar.
- If the right sidebar isn’t open, click the arrow or Comments button on the right-side of the screen.
- Click the comment you’d like to edit or delete.
- Click Edit or Delete.
How are comments ordered in the comment pane?
Comments are listed in different orders, depending on the type of file you’re viewing.
- If you’re viewing an audio or video file, the default sort order is by timeframe. For example, a comment posted at 01:11 will be listed before a comment posted at 02:07.
- If you’re viewing a file with multiple pages, the default sort order is by pages. For example, a comment posted on page 1 will be listed before a comment posted on page 5.
- If you’re viewing any other type of file, the default sort order is from newest to oldest comment.
For any file you’re viewing, you can change the sort order by clicking the Sort by dropdown below Comments in the right sidebar.
Who is notified when I leave a comment?
The following people will receive an email and a notification both on dropbox.com and on their connected devices:
- The file owner
- Anyone who has subscribed to the file
- Anyone who has commented on the comment thread
- Anyone who was @mentioned in the comment thread

What timezone are comment timestamps shown in?
Comment timestamps are shown in your device’s time zone. For example, if your device is set to Pacific Standard Time, then all comment timestamps you see will be shown in Pacific Standard Time.
